FAQS

What types of projects can you handle with your sawmill services?

Our sawmill services are versatile enough to support a wide range of projects including new construction, historic preservation, timber framing, post and beam construction, and customized home projects. We also specialize in barn restorations and can handle large-scale commercial and residential needs.

Can you process large logs on my property?

Yes, our on-site milling services include a mobile sawmill that can travel to your property to process logs directly into usable lumber. Our Alaskan Sawmill can handle logs up to 54 inches wide, perfect for turning large logs into slabs for tabletops, bars, and other custom uses.

What does your planer service include?

Our planer service uses a four-head moulder planer to convert rough lumber into finished products like shiplap, flooring, decking, and trim boards in a single pass. This service provides you with ready-to-install materials tailored to your project specifications.

How does your kiln-drying process work?

We use small batch kilns to dry wood to your exact specifications. This controlled drying process ensures the wood is conditioned perfectly for its intended use, minimizing warping and shrinkage and preparing it for construction or woodworking projects.
